AMRPI: The Future of Intelligent Material Resource Planning
In the coming years, the manufacturing world will witness a profound shift—one that redefines how industries plan, produce, and optimize. At the heart of this transformation lies AMRPI: Artificial Intelligence in Material Resource Planning for Industry.
AMRPI is not just a technological upgrade to existing MRP systems. It is a strategic evolution, a movement that will reshape industrial ecosystems by embedding intelligence, adaptability, and foresight into the very fabric of resource planning.

Research Leadership
The initiative will foster deep collaboration between academia, industry, and AI labs. Research will focus on:
- Reinforcement learning for dynamic inventory control
- Generative AI for scenario planning
- Causal AI for understanding complex dependencies in supply chains

Technologies That Will Power AMRPI
Digital Twins
Simulating entire production environments for predictive planning.
Edge AI
Making decisions at the machine level with minimal latency.
Federated Learning
Enabling secure, decentralized learning across multiple plants.
Natural Language Interfaces
Allowing planners to interact with systems conversationally.
